  • M&A Vice President at BDA New York

    Role of the Vice President

    BDA Partners is seeking a highly motivated Vice President for its New York office. BDA provides an excellent opportunity to gain an expansive breadth of hands-on experience across sectors focusing on M&A (sellside and buyside) and capital raising.

    The prospective candidate will provide project management and execution support on complex transactions and prepare presentation materials to communicate key messages to clients and counterparties. Specific duties will include assistance in the preparation of financial models, valuation analysis, marketing documentation and research.

    As well as having a deep understanding of valuation and broad finance, Associates should be able to identify and vet potential buyers from pitch materials and support sector teams in developing various client ready materials.

     

    Responsibilities

    Successful candidates will support deal teams with a wide variety of tasks around our M&A advisory mandates. In particular, an Vice President’s work will typically cover the following:

    • Direct and manage the work of Associates and Analysts on the execution of international Mergers &
      Acquisitions (M&A) and divestments transactions from company valuation analysis and conducting due
      diligence to deal structuring and negotiations.
    • Maintain effective relationships with existing clients on behalf of the company.
    • Design and conduct training and performance evaluations of Associates and Analysts.
    • Develop market data in international M&A and accordingly advise clients on current and future
      financial status of their respective transactions.
    • Source opportunities for M&A transactions and actively develop new clients and credentials while
      actively participating in sectors class and related marketing activities.
    • Analyze risks and impacts of client companies’ M&A transactions.
    • Review M&A transaction reports and industry views, analyze market conditions, and provide feedback
      and suggestions to Associate/Analyst.
    • Review and optimize the financial models built by Associate/Analyst and provide valuation guidance to
      clients for M&A transactions.
    • Serve as central point for coordination internally and externally with clients, co-advisors, lawyers,
      accountants as well as potential transaction counterparties; liaise with external advisors on valuation and
      strategy.
    • Lead the team to prepare pitch books and transaction materials, including Teasers, Process Letters,
      Information Memorandums, Term Sheets, Stock/Asset Purchase Agreements.

     

    Essential (‘Core’) Competencies

    • Master’s Degree (or foreign equivalent) in Finance or related fields and three years of work experience as an Associate, Analyst or related
    • Strong quantitative and accounting skills – Having a deep understanding of valuation and broad finance and should be able to guide and challenge juniors in financial modeling
    • Experience working on deals through the entire execution phase. Experience working on cross-border mandates welcomed
    • Strong client management skills – ability to earn the trust and respect of client teams such that clients contact him/her first for daily tasks
    •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, strong work ethic, a “team player,” organized and high level of attention to detail
    • Strong leadership mindset – able to facilitate more effective delivery by working with junior team to improve performance
    • Willingness to travel
